# The peculiarities of emission of He(z=2) projectile fragments in the   interactions of gold nuclei with Ag, Br emulssion nuclei at the energies of   10.6 AGeV

## Abstract

In the interactions of gold nuclei with the energy 10.6 AGeV with the Ag, Br emulssion nuclei at the intermadiate impact parametes the dependencies of characteristics of individual emission acts of He-fragmetns on the centrality of the interaction and the degree of nucleus disintegration.
